Battlecode 2023 Postmortem

I did Battlecode this IAP (Independent Activities Period, essentially MIT’s winter term) in a team with two other people. I was a total beginner to Java and algorithms at the beginning of the competition, having only coded before for research purposes, but I read a blog post about Battlecode and thought it seemed fun. So I signed up with Reece Yang and Jade Chongsathapornpong, and we agreed to participate casually. Our team, no thoughts head empty, ultimately won second place in the Newbie Tournament, a subset of the competition for first-time competitors at MIT.
